Common Misconceptions Regarding Inspection Frequency
One common false impression concerning evaluation frequency is that conducting inspections only when there are visible indicators of pests suffices. While awaiting noticeable signs might appear like an affordable strategy, insects can typically stay hidden up until their numbers have dramatically enhanced, making it harder and much more costly to eradicate them.
Regular assessments, even in the absence of obvious insect discoveries, can assist identify invasions in their onset, protecting against considerable damages to your home.
Performance of Preventative Measures
To properly take care of parasite invasions, carrying out preventative actions is essential in maintaining a pest-free atmosphere. Right here are 4 crucial actions you can take to maintain insects away:
1. ** Seal Access Things: ** Conduct an extensive examination of your home to recognize and secure any kind of fractures or openings where insects can go into. Usage caulk or weather removing to seal voids around windows, doors, pipes, and vents.
2. ** Appropriate Food Storage: ** Store food in closed containers and ensure that your cupboard and kitchen area are clean and devoid of crumbs. On a regular basis tidy kitchen counters, tables, and floors to remove food resources that draw in pests.
